Why Choose a Coffee Machine With Beans?

scott-uk-slimissimo-fully-automatic-bean-to-cup-coffee-machine-19-bar-pressure-1-1l-1470w-1813.jpgA coffee machine that utilizes beans can make rich, flavourful and balanced cups of coffee at the touch of one button. They are also simple to operate and maintain.

They also save you money over time, making it possible to use less expensive ground coffee instead of costly capsules or pods. They are also environmentally friendly.

Easy to use

Bean to cup machines make it possible to make coffee of high quality without the need for baristas. The machine grinds the beans, and then brews it to produce rich, delicious coffee cups every time. The machine can do this with precision, which means that the coffee is brewed to the right temperature and strength. Additionally, the best bean to cup coffee machine machine can steam milk, which enables you to create a variety of coffee drinks.

The machine lets you alter the amount of coffee each person is given. This is helpful for offices with many different preferences and needs. You can pick the size of the cup, the strength of the coffee and the type of coffee you prefer. You can choose if you would like to add creamer or sugar.

These coffee machines are simple to operate and use. They can produce a variety of different coffee beverages including cappuccinos and espressos, as well as hot chocolate and tea. The machine can be programmed to automatically turn on at certain times. This makes it convenient to use whenever you need to get a quick fix of coffee.

A bean-to cup coffee machine can also help you save money over the course of time. These machines can be utilized for catering in offices and are often more cost-effective than traditional commercial coffee machines. They can also be used by restaurants and businesses to provide a high-quality coffee to their patrons and employees.

Contrary to preground coffees whole beans preserve their flavour for longer, and provide a more consistent taste than packaged ground coffee. The coffee is made from fresh, unaltered beans machine that are made according to your preferences. The machine will crush the beans, measure them and tamp them to create the puck of ground coffee, which is then pushed under high pressure through hot water to create your beverage.

The process is fast, efficient, and results in a superior cup of coffee that will please the most discerning of customers. Additionally, the machine is eco-friendly, as no waste is produced and it uses fewer resources than other machines.

Easy to clean

Cleaning ease is an important consideration when choosing a commercial coffee machine. Since the machine will be regularly used (and sometimes more than once) it is important that cleaning is as easy and quick as possible. The best bean-to-cup machines are designed with easy cleaning in mind So you can be confident that they will keep your office looking good and tasting great.

A majority of the models we tested included a self-cleaning function which removes both coffee grounds and milk residues left behind after a brew. This feature is especially useful for coffee makers that see a large amount of use every day, since it can save time and money. A clean machine will make a better cup.

A bean-to cup machine is an excellent choice for offices since it can serve a range of beverages and is perfect for the busy workplace. It is easy to adjust the settings of a bean to cup machine to meet your individual preferences, and it can even warm and texturize milk for a one-press latte.

The main benefit of a coffee machine that is bean-to-cup is that it grinds whole beans prior making coffee, which guarantees highest quality. Bean-to-cup coffee machines allow you to select the type of coffee bean and the strength of the beverage. This allows you to find the perfect cup for every occasion. Certain bean-to cup coffee machines come with a filter system that reduces waste and offers an alternative to coffee that is already ground.

If you do not clean your coffee maker often minerals may build up and cause damage. These deposits, also referred to as scales, could affect the flavor and performance of your machine. Mineral buildup is usually a sign that the machine requires descaling and the procedure is easily accomplished with a mixture of water and white vinegar. Be sure to check the manual of the manufacturer to find out how for descaling, as some manufacturers advise against using vinegar and provide specific solutions for descaling.

The majority of bean-to-cup machines have an integrated coffee grinder that grinds coffee beans machine to an appropriate size. This ensures that the right amount of ground coffee is used for the brew. The coffee beans are put in the hopper, and then the water is added. The mixture is then pressed, and the coffee is dispersed in a precise time.

Bean-to-cup coffee machines typically come with a hopper which you can fill up with your favorite beans. You can select the beverage from the menu when the Coffeee Machine is ready. The hopper will drop the proper amount of beans into the grinder, where they'll be crushed to a suitable size for extraction. Many of these machines have the option of allowing you to alter your grinding process. This gives you more control over the final flavor of your coffee.

The Sage Barista Touch Impress is a great example of a bean-to cup coffee maker that offers a hands-off experience. Its digital display provides step-by-step guidance and feedback on the entire process of brewing, from grinding and tamping to extraction and texturing milk. It has prompts for adjusting the size of the grind or temperature of water if needed which makes it easy for beginners.
